Output 66040eefe63ab7e78d16cb0a2ff2bb4df53e793431af546d395397fcc1201e61:1

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59c8c66220e4ccfa14220ffc0bf6016b115c760c05af3b586ed24b2203a13336
address
tb1pt8yvvc3qunx059pzpl7qhaspdvg4casvqkhnkkrw6f9jyqapxvmq2rwc4j
transaction
66040eefe63ab7e78d16cb0a2ff2bb4df53e793431af546d395397fcc1201e61
confirmations
24516
spent
false

1 Sat Range